LLS2V102MELC Equivalent & Substitute Parts

Part Overview

The LLS2V102MELC is a 1000 µF, 350 V aluminum electrolytic capacitor manufactured by Nichicon in a radial, can snap-in package. This component is designed for general-purpose applications requiring high-capacitance energy storage at elevated voltage ratings. Engineering Selection Recommendations

Both the LLS2V102MELC and ESMQ351VSN102MA50S are active production parts with full RoHS compliance and REACH unaffected status. The primary distinction between these parts is the rated lifetime at 85°C: the LLS2V102MELC provides 3000 hours while the ESMQ351VSN102MA50S provides 2000 hours. Selection should be based on application lifetime requirements and thermal operating conditions. Both parts are suitable for general-purpose applications and are mechanically and electrically interchangeable within the specified operating parameters. The 2 mm height difference (52 mm versus 50 mm) must be verified against PCB layout constraints and enclosure clearances.

Frequently Asked Questions (FAQ)

Q: Can ESMQ351VSN102MA50S replace LLS2V102MELC in all applications?

A: Yes, provided that the application does not require the extended 3000-hour lifetime rating at 85°C. The ESMQ351VSN102MA50S is rated for 2000 hours at 85°C. Both parts are electrically and mechanically equivalent for all other parameters.

Q: What is the significance of the height difference between these parts?

A: The LLS2V102MELC has a seated height of 2.047" (52.00 mm) while the ESMQ351VSN102MA50S has a seated height of 1.969" (50.00 mm). This 2 mm difference must be evaluated against PCB layout, component clearances, and enclosure dimensions to ensure mechanical fit.

Q: Are both parts RoHS compliant?

A: Yes. The LLS2V102MELC is ROHS3 compliant and the ESMQ351VSN102MA50S is RoHS compliant. Both meet regulatory requirements for hazardous substance restrictions.

Q: What are the ripple current specifications for these capacitors?

A: The LLS2V102MELC is rated for 3.6 A at 120 Hz and 5.148 A at 50 kHz. The ESMQ351VSN102MA50S is rated for 4.64 A at 120 Hz and 5.062 A at 50 kHz. Both specifications are suitable for general-purpose applications within their respective thermal and voltage operating ranges.

Q: Can these capacitors be used interchangeably on the same PCB?

A: Yes, provided that the 2 mm height difference does not create mechanical interference with adjacent components or enclosure constraints. Lead spacing, diameter, and mounting type are identical, ensuring direct PCB compatibility.
